    Abstract: A method is disclosed for determining a mitigation strategy to limit a potential source of interference on an Internet Protocol television (IPTV) system. A new user installation request is received at a server in the IPTV system. A first geographical location of a customer premises associated with the new user installation request is received. A second geographical location of an amplitude modulation broadcasting facility is received. A first distance between the first geographical location and the second geographical location is determined. A first signal transmission power rating for the amplitude modulation broadcasting facility is retrieved from a database. A first mitigation strategy causing filters to filter an IPTV signal according to a frequency range associated with the amplitude modulation broadcasting facility to limit a first interference on the IPTV signal provided to the first geographical location when the first distance is less than the first threshold distance is determined.

    Abstract: Methods and apparatus to detect wideband interference in digital subscriber line (DSL) systems are disclosed. An example method comprises retrieving a first plurality of performance parameters for a first time interval for respective ones of a plurality of DSL modems, wherein each of the plurality of DSL modems are associated with respective ones of a plurality of subscriber loops, and comparing each of the performance parameters to a threshold to determine whether two or more of the respective ones of the plurality of subscriber loops experienced respective performance degradations during the first time interval.

    Abstract: A method for calculating availability in line power systems composed of power circuit modules determines power circuit parameters associated with the power circuits, accepting input from central databases. The method calculates a required number of power circuits to complete the line power system, and calculates the total power to be delivered over the power system, based on a power calculator. The method calculates individual power circuit availabilities based on the power circuit compositions and external variables. The method then calculates an overall system availability based on the power circuit availabilities and other external variable inputs. The method may compare the calculated line power system availability with a target availability, revise the power circuit parameters, and recalculate the system availability to meet the target availability.

    Abstract: A system and method are disclosed for configuring power loops between a central office (CO) 106 and a service access interface (SAI) 110. A system that incorporates teachings of the present disclosure may include, for example, a network management system (NMS) 100 having a memory 104, and a controller 102. The controller is programmed to retrieve (206) topology information relating to a selected power loop originating at a CO and terminating at an SAI, identify (207) environment conditions to be applied to the selected power loop, and determine (208, 218) from the topology information and the environment conditions whether the power loop can carry sufficient energy without exceeding a temperature rating.
